Mark Edwards
As this series of paintings develop, Mark Edwards is aware that certain characters or events may eventually explain what this ‘White Wood’ and its male inhabitants are all about.
“This ‘White Wood’ series intrigues me as much as it appears to do for others” says Mark Edwards, “For me it’s far more surreal and intangible... occasionally humorous, sometimes disturbing”.
It would be too grandiose to suggest the paintings are a metaphor for the isolation we all on occasions feel, but the ‘White Wood’ appears to promote personal interpretation, something that he finds immensely absorbing.
Mark Edwards lives just east of Cape Wrath in the Scottish Highlands.
